User-Agent:       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; Intel Mac OS X; en-US; rv:1.8.1b1) Gecko/20060710 Firefox/2.0b1
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; Intel Mac OS X; en-US; rv:1.8.1b1) Gecko/20060710 Firefox/2.0b1

Setting the preference to open links in a new tab in the most recent window does not work. Links continue to open in a new window. This bug only affects the Mac version. I've tested the Windows XP version, and links open in new tabs as expected.

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Click on any link that normally opens a new window (such as links with target="_blank" attribute)

Actual Results:  
A new window opens and the page loads. 

Expected Results:  
A new tab opens in the most recent window and the page loads.

This bug is reproducible with ANY link that would normally open a new window. It happens ONLY in the Mac version of Firefox; the Windows version works correctly.
